FAQs for booking Milwaukee to Venice flights

  • What is the cheapest flight from Milwaukee to Venice Marco Polo Airport?

    In the last 3 days, the lowest price for a flight from Milwaukee to Venice Marco Polo Airport was $371 for a one-way ticket and $710 for a round-trip.

  • Do I need a passport to fly between Milwaukee and Venice?

    Yes, you’ll need a passport to travel to Venice from Milwaukee.

  • Which airports will I be using when flying from Milwaukee to Venice?

    Milwaukee airport is called Milwaukee-Mitchell and the only airport in Venice is Venice Marco Polo.

  • Which aircraft models fly most regularly from Milwaukee to Venice?

    We unfortunately don’t have that data for this specific route.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from Milwaukee to Venice?

    oneworld, SkyTeam, and Star Alliance are the airline alliances operating flights between Milwaukee and Venice, with oneworld being the most commonly used for this route.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Milwaukee to Venice?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Venice with an airline and back to Milwaukee with another airline. Booking your flights between Milwaukee and VCE can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.
